Abstract:
The pKT54 B7 C5 plasmid wi th B. t. k. - del ta endoxin gene w ere t rnsferred intoHeino ng 37 and Heino ng 39 et. al soy bean cultiva rs by inducting wi th v arious ex plantmethods. Adv enti tio us buds a nd regenera tion plant w ere obtained f rom hy pocotyl ,cotylendo n node. They were detected by kanamycine selectio n and alkaoids and primarilyprov ed that fo reig n gene were t ransferred into so ybean genome. Only 30 o f 81 regeneratedpla nt surviv ed. Only 3 plants wi th 7 pods w ere obtained f rom the surviv ed regeneratedplant s. It prov ed that 7 plants of the reg enerated plant s w ere t ra nsferred w ithfo rg ein g ene by PCR technique a nd dot hybri zatio n. The 7 seeds spro uted, plant g row this normal.
